Takuya Satoh
We present our recent findings on the discovery of chiral phonons in intrinsically chiral materials such as α-HgS [1], Te [2], and related compounds, revealed through circularly polarized Raman scattering and first-principles calculations. These chiral phonons not only carry angular momentum but also exhibit chirality characterized by the pseudoscalar quantity G0. Furthermore, we explore the possibility of exciting chiral phonons in achiral materials, irrespective of the presence or absence of spatial inversion symmetry.
